Resilience and interdependence are essential for a community to thrive. At The Community School (TCS), these mutually beneficial relationships are modeled daily in the approach to teaching and learning. Join friend of TCS and Terrestrial Ecologist, Tom Wessels, for a reflective conversation about how Place-based Education in action at TCS mirrors the interdependent and resilient relationships observed in the natural world that have been successful for millions of years. Following the talk, founding director of The Community School, Jasmine Smith, will lead an art activity, illustrating the interconnected relationships among living things.
